In 2020-2021, 13,674 people earned their degree in physics, making the major the 68th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, physics gra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$42,960 and had an average of $22,756 in loans still to pay off.

Across Idaho, there were 56 physics graduates with average earnings and debt of $31,275 and $25,752 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 2 physics graduates with average earnings and debt of $36,761 and $18,399 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ools for an Associate Highly Focused on Physics Major in Idaho” ranking, we looked at 3 colleges that offer a degree in physics. That schools that top this list have a program in physics in which the largest percentage of students at the school are enrolled.
